Those long-talked-about service changes are coming to the L Train this Friday, April 26. But before then, there are overnight service changes we'll have to deal with as well.

The overnight changes start Monday night at 10:30 p.m. and last until 5 a.m. the next morning until this Friday.

On Friday, starting at 8 p.m. to 5 a.m., on Monday morning, L Trains will run every 20 minutes between Brooklyn and Manhattan, and every 10 minutes within Brooklyn.

That frequency of trains will last the entire weekend, every weekend as the major rehabilitation project goes on.

Alternate travel options include increased M, G, and 7 Train service, as well as more frequent M 14 bus services.

Officials also say they are working with environmental consultants and contractors to ensure there is no danger to commuters during the construction.
